ENGL.3150 Old English Language and Literature (Formerly 42.315)

Id: 030353 Credits: 3-3

Description

Students will acquire reading knowledge of the Old English Language, spending half the semester mastering grammar and vocabulary, and the second half translating texts such as The Wanderer, Dream of the Rood, and Beowulf. Attention will also be given to early medieval cultures in England.

Prerequisites

Pre-Req: ENGL.1020 College Writing II.
